A lovely little trip into yesteryear. The beautifully restored buildings and paved roads are a feast for the eye. If you're into gemstones and fossils, stop by the little shop in the village and be sure to check out the little room with black lights and glowing crystals.

Beautiful vintage, retro cobblestone village with 'out of the box' shops, gems, crafts, woodwork wares, a Cafe, lead lighting shop, retro clothes, homade soaps and so much more. There's a vintage classroom and church, art hub, toilets, a Saturday market, and a cute little bush walk that you may find painted rocks hiding. Well worth a visit!

The best time to visit the Historical village is the weekend, especially when there is a market happening. Also a great place to go when there is a new artist showing in the small art gallery there. During the school holidays they hold childrens activities which you need to book for- they seemed very popular.
